What is the IELTS?

The IELTS test is developed to evaluate the English language abilities of individuals in four crucial locations:

  1. Listening
  2. Reading
  3. Composing
  4. Speaking

Candidates receive a score ranging from 0 to 9 in each section, with scores balanced to offer a general band score.

IELTS Pass Score in Uzbekistan

The pass score for the IELTS might differ depending upon the specific requirements of organizations or organizations in Uzbekistan. Typically, a good IELTS rating ranges from 6.0 to 7.5, with:

  • 6.0: Acceptable for numerous undergraduate programs and some job applications.
  • 7.0 or higher: Preferred for postgraduate studies and more competitive job functions.
FunctionRequired IELTS Score
Undergraduate Studies6.0 - 6.5
Postgraduate Studies6.5 - 7.5
Immigration (e.g., UK, Canada)6.0 - 7.0
Work in International Firms6.5 - 8.0

Elements Influencing IELTS Pass Scores

  1. University or Institution: Different universities and colleges have differing score requirements for admission.
  2. Discipline: Programs that need extensive communication skills, such as humanities or social sciences, may need a greater rating.
  3. Kind Of IELTS Test: The IELTS Academic test may require a different rating than the General Training test.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What is the validity period of an IELTS rating?

Answer: An IELTS rating stands for 2 years from the date of the test. After this duration, prospects may need to retake the test to meet the requirements of academic institutes or companies.

2. Can I retake the IELTS if I am not satisfied with my rating?

Response: Yes, prospects can select to retake the IELTS test as numerous times as they wish. Nevertheless, it is advisable to prepare thoroughly before trying the test again.

3. Is the IELTS test carried out in Uzbekistan?

Response: Yes, IELTS tests are performed regularly in numerous cities throughout Uzbekistan, consisting of Tashkent and Samarkand. Prospects can inspect the official IELTS website for upcoming test dates and locations.
